I Have a Good Reason for Only Charging My iPhone to 95%

Posted on May 31, 2025May 31, 2025 by Ali Khan

I’m prolonging the life of my iPhone’s battery by configuring a Charge Limit in iOS.

The majority of contemporary phones, including those that are midrange or inexpensive, can last you a whole day between charges. Since I have the most recent model of iPhone, my battery will last me at least 24 hours. Therefore, I’m concentrating on my phone’s battery lifespan—that is, how long the battery lasts during the phone’s life—rather than its daily battery life.

Reducing the amount of time your phone spends charging when its battery is at 100% is one method to extend its battery life. Stress can be experienced by a fully charged battery, which shortens its lifespan and accelerates its degradation.

Thanks to Optimized Battery Charging, your iPhone could already be figuring out how to charge. You may leave your gadget plugged in overnight and it won’t fully charge until the following morning if you have this function activated.

How to establish a limit on charges

Charge Limit is a feature that gives you even more control over your iPhone’s battery. You may lessen the burden on your device’s battery by preventing it from reaching its full potential by setting a Charge Limit.

On the iPhone 15 or later models, you may activate Charge Limit by selecting Settings > Battery > Charging. There, you may select a percentage between 80% and 100% in 5% increments. (Keep in mind that you may only turn on Optimized Battery Charging when it is at 100%.)

Is it ever appropriate to fully charge your phone?

Apple claims that a charge limit helps extend the life of your phone’s battery, and depending on how you use it, iOS may suggest one. The function may benefit your iPhone in the long run, even if you simply use it to limit your charge to 95%.

If your phone is still connected in when the battery is full, though, you shouldn’t lose sleep. According to CNET writer and phone reviewer Patrick Holland, “there are so many different variables that affect battery age and longevity besides just filling it up to 100%.” “Apple and other phone manufacturers employ software to reduce such influences and, if they so want, provide customers with means to take control of that. However, there is a balance, so people shouldn’t be scared to use their phones to the fullest extent possible.”

Sometimes, even with Charge Limit activated, your iPhone may still show 100% charge. “If you have Charge Limit set to less than 100 percent, your iPhone will occasionally charge to 100 percent to maintain accurate battery state-of-charge estimates,” said Apple.
